Common Boat Dock Repair Jobs
Dock deck repairs - replacing or fixing damaged planks to ensure safety and stability.
Structural reinforcement - strengthening the underlying supports to prevent sagging or collapse.
Floating dock repairs - addressing issues with buoyancy, leaks, or damaged flotation devices.
Pile and post repairs - replacing or reinforcing support pilings to maintain dock integrity.
Hardware and connector fixes - replacing rusted or broken bolts, cleats, and brackets for secure attachment.
Surface resurfacing - restoring worn or splintered decking for a smooth, safe surface.
Boat Dock Repair Questions
What types of boat dock repairs are commonly requested? Repairs often include replacing damaged pilings, fixing decking boards, and restoring support structures to ensure safety and stability.
How can I tell if my boat dock needs repairs? Visible signs such as rotting wood, loose boards, cracked pilings, or uneven surfaces indicate that repairs may be necessary.
Are there different repair options for different dock materials? Yes, repairs are tailored to dock materials like wood, vinyl, or composite, addressing specific issues related to each type.
What should property owners consider before repairing a boat dock? It's important to assess the extent of damage, plan for necessary permits, and ensure repairs meet local safety standards.
